Grants for quality of life aim to improve health, wellness, and well-being for individuals and communities. These grants focus on promoting happiness and community benefits by providing access to resources and promoting social well-being through social activities and community services. The goal is to enhance the quality of life for local residents and create a positive impact on the community. These grants can help to improve access to resources and create opportunities for socializing, ultimately leading to an overall improvement in quality of life for everyone.
